During our weekend trip to Grindelwald, Switzerland, in April 2007, we were staying at the hotel Jungfrau Lodge in Grindelwald. We had a comfortable double room, overlooking the breathtaking mountain scenery of the Bernese Oberland including the spectacular Eiger north face (Eigernordwand, "Eiger Wall"), one of the six great north faces of the Alps, towering over 1800 m (5900 ft) above the valley. Hardly believable that the Jungfrau Railway - a pioneer of all mountain railways - has a 7 kilometres / 4 miles tunnel through the Eiger rock, with its terminus on the Jungfraujoch at 3454 m / 11333 ft, Europe's highest altitude railway station!
